Subject[PATCH 1/1] KVM: fix lock imbalance
Date
Stanse found 2 lock imbalances in kvm_request_irq_source_id and
kvm_free_irq_source_id. They omit to unlock kvm->irq_lock on fail paths.

Fix that by adding unlock labels at the end of the functions and jump
there from the fail paths.

virt/kvm/irq_comm.c | 7 +++++--
1 files changed, 5 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)

diff --git a/virt/kvm/irq_comm.c b/virt/kvm/irq_comm.c
index 15a83b9..00c68d2 100644
--- a/virt/kvm/irq_comm.c
+++ b/virt/kvm/irq_comm.c
@@ -220,11 +220,13 @@ int kvm_request_irq_source_id(struct kvm *kvm)

if (irq_source_id >= sizeof(kvm->arch.irq_sources_bitmap)) {
printk(KERN_WARNING "kvm: exhaust allocatable IRQ sources!\n");
- return -EFAULT;
+ irq_source_id = -EFAULT;
+ goto unlock;
}

ASSERT(irq_source_id != KVM_USERSPACE_IRQ_SOURCE_ID);
set_bit(irq_source_id, bitmap);
+unlock:
mutex_unlock(&kvm->irq_lock);

return irq_source_id;
@@ -240,7 +242,7 @@ void kvm_free_irq_source_id(struct kvm *kvm, int irq_source_id)
if (irq_source_id < 0 ||
irq_source_id >= sizeof(kvm->arch.irq_sources_bitmap)) {
printk(KERN_ERR "kvm: IRQ source ID out of range!\n");
- return;
+ goto unlock;
}
for (i = 0; i < KVM_IOAPIC_NUM_PINS; i++) {
clear_bit(irq_source_id, &kvm->arch.vioapic->irq_states[i]);
@@ -251,6 +253,7 @@ void kvm_free_irq_source_id(struct kvm *kvm, int irq_source_id)
#endif
}
clear_bit(irq_source_id, &kvm->arch.irq_sources_bitmap);
+unlock:
mutex_unlock(&kvm->irq_lock);
}
